AS Soleuvre C left Contern with a 74-65 road win, levelling the season series 1-1 after AB Contern C had taken the first meeting 75-64. The game swung early on a barrage from Cédric Demontis (Season PPG: 12.00), who drilled three consecutive threes in the first quarter and four in the opening period overall, pushing Soleuvre to a 12-18 lead and later to the night's largest gap at +11 (12-23, 17-28, 20-31). Contern reacted just before halftime with a 9-0 run capped by Sébastien Hommel to make it 34-35 at the break.
After the interval, Soleuvre reasserted control behind Vincent Sunnen (31), whose outside touch repeatedly punished defensive gaps, including back-to-back triples that restored a two-possession cushion late in the third (48-54). In the fourth, Michel Kirsch's two early threes briefly reignited Contern (54-56), and a long-range make by Christophe Manuel Torres dos Santos (37, PRT) was corrected to two points, keeping the game within one shot. The decisive sequence came in the final two minutes: Gary André Pleimling (33) hit two big threes, and Carlos Jordy Borges (24, NLD) calmly sank two free throws in a row, sealing a closing 5-0 that set the final margin.
Top performers
- Contern: Hommel (22, Season PPG: 4.85) carried the offense; Kirsch (13, Season PPG: 11.56) and Christian Harr (11, Season PPG: 6.14) provided support; Torres dos Santos added 11.
- Soleuvre: Sunnen (19) and Demontis (17) led, with Borges (13) steady on both ends and Pleimling (12, all from long range) delivering late.
Coaches: Tim Geiben's Soleuvre managed the key moments better than Contern's player-coach Sébastien Hommel. In the table, Soleuvre climbs to 3rd (+2) and extends its streak to four wins; Contern sits 6th (+4) despite a third straight loss.
